Arrive in August. Stay for the Music Festival.
The 34th annual Moab Music Festival runs September 2–18, 2026 — one of the most celebrated chamber music, jazz, and world music events in the American Southwest. Performances take place at breathtaking venues including a natural stone river grotto and guided wilderness hikes. Moab Music Festival — September 2–18, 2026
The 34th annual festival features award-winning artists in some of the most remarkable performance venues on earth.
Grammy-winning jazz vocalist Cécile McLorin Salvant at Red Cliffs Lodge
Floating concerts on the Colorado River at the wilderness Grotto
Music Hikes: live performances in secret wilderness locations
Free community concert at Old City Park — open to all
Cataract Canyon Musical Raft Trip with chef Kenji López-Alt (Sept. 15–18)
